| 0:33.6 | We start today with a final decision years in the making. |
| 0:40.4 | No federal charges against police involved in the death of Eric Garner. |
| 0:44.0 | Some have promised protests in New York City today because today also marks exactly five years since Garner died. |
| 0:50.0 | Remember, Garner was a 43 year old unarmed black man seen in a video that went viral five years ago. |
| 0:56.9 | He was saying, I can't breathe, after he was apparently put in a chokehold, and it was one of the |
| 1:01.7 | videos that sparked the Black Lives Matter movement. |
| 1:04.0 | Well, NBC news reports, the investigation came to an end yesterday. |
| 1:08.0 | U.S. Attorney General William Barr decided not to bring civil rights or criminal charges against any of the NYPD officers involved. |
| 1:15.8 | The Washington Post reports bar ultimately decided that prosecutors could not prove there |
| 1:19.8 | was a federal crime, that they didn't have enough evidence to show the officer used too much force. |
